Latest Patents
One of his latest inventions is the welding condition inputting equipment. This innovative device allows users to set welding conditions, such as welding current and voltage, easily and securely. The equipment features an operating section for inputting these conditions, a determining section for selecting relevant items, and a display section for showcasing the selected items. The operating section includes a dial, a switch, and a push-in dial switch that integrates a dial rotation detecting part. This invention enhances the user experience by streamlining the input process for welding conditions.
